Output d95418e5158abcedc39ff04c4fa61cd6f0f8f3cb813dad88d28548d622ddb12f:0

value
2663550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e270602038310030c28809575f64f88c4d593b7 OP_EQUAL
address
3QrrJfdKmJB3Qt4MmDLpG7VK6jdMckTKVX
transaction
d95418e5158abcedc39ff04c4fa61cd6f0f8f3cb813dad88d28548d622ddb12f
spent
true